Are you still renting?  Tri-City, WA (Kennewick-Pasco-Richland & Surrounding Cities) residents pay an average of $800 per month in rent.  Did you know that you can purchase a home in Kennewick, Pasco or Richland and lower your monthly housing expenses?  All three cities offer first time buyers down payment assistance depending on your income qualifications and the location of your purchase.
The USDA Rural Housing Program offers zero down loans in Burbank, Finley, Benton City, Prosser and North Pasco. These loans are not reserved for first time buyers but you cannot currently own a home.  The seller can pay ALL of the costs associated … (1 comments)
